WebThere are also many tests to evaluate the high ankle sprain. These tests are: 1. SQUEEZE TEST – This test is start with compression of the fibula to the tibia above the midpoint of the calf causing separation of the two bones distally. The test is said to be positive if it causes pain in the area of the syndesmosis ( high ankle area). Web21 de jan. de 2024 · Diagnosing a high ankle sprain Because syndesmotic sprains can …

WebA high ankle sprain, also known as a syndesmotic ankle sprain (SAS), is a sprain of the syndesmotic ligaments that connect the tibia and fibula in the lower leg, thereby creating a mortise and tenon joint for the ankle. High ankle sprains are described as high because they are located above the ankle. They comprise approximately 15% of all ankle sprains. 1. Dorsiflexion External Rotation Stress Test (Kleiger's Test) 1. Determines rotator damage to the deltoid ligament or the distal tibiofibular syndesmosis. 2. Performed by having the knee flexed by 90 degrees with the ankle in neutral position and appyling an external rotational force to the affected foot and ankle. 3.
